Publication number: 20090243856Abstract: Disclosed herein is a system for managing chemicals using Radio-Frequency Identification (RFID). A storage facility identification tag, attached to a chemical storage facility in a laboratory, stores the unique identification code of the chemical storage facility and a list of chemicals. A chemical identification tag, attached to the cover of a chemical container, stores the unique identification code of the chemical storage facility and chemical-related information. A mobile terminal, provided with an RFID reader, receives and outputs the unique identification code of the chemical storage facility, the list of the chemicals, and the chemical-related information.Type: ApplicationFiled: October 30, 2008Publication date: October 1, 2009Applicant: REPUBLIC OF KOREA (KOREA FOOD & DRUG ADMINISTRATION)Inventors: Sang Mok Lee, Kun Sang Park, Woo Sung Kim, Ho Il Kang, Chang Hee Lee, Dong Kil Lim, Yong Suk Ko, So Hee Kim, Dae Hyun Jo, Dai Byung Kim, Won Gon Yoo

Patent number: 7574130Abstract: Disclosed is a mobile communication terminal having a camera function and a method of controlling a photographing process thereof. According to an embodiment of the disclosure, the mobile communication terminal comprises two buttons relating to the camera function positioned separately on a main body of the terminal. A first button is a photographing button that captures an image when on-state and a second button is a supporting button, provided the user chooses to activate this function. In this setup, the mobile communication terminal protrudes a camera lens or takes a photograph only when the first and the second buttons are in the on state. Accordingly, it is possible to reduce the possibility of dropping the terminal due to carelessness during photography, and to decrease the possibility of damaging the camera lens even when the terminal is dropped on the ground.Type: GrantFiled: December 19, 2005Date of Patent: August 11, 2009Assignee: Pantech Co., Ltd.Inventor: Woo Sung Kim

Patent number: 7408739Abstract: A hard disk drive (HDD) having a spindle motor, at least one data storage disk, a disk clamp fastened to the spindle motor and fixing the disk to the spindle motor, and at least one disk spacer mounted on the spindle motor to support the disk. The disk spacer includes a ring-shaped disk spacer body fitted around an outer circumference of the spindle motor with at least one surface contacting the disk, a first groove on the surface of the spacer body contacting the disk, a second groove on the surface of the spacer body contacting the disk to extend along both sides of the first groove, and a damping member between the spacer body and the disk to reduce vibrations of the disk, seated in the first groove in a normal state and compressed by the disk, a portion of which is deformed and accommodated in the second groove.Type: GrantFiled: January 19, 2006Date of Patent: August 5, 2008Assignee: Samsung Electronics Co., Ltd.Inventors: Kwang-kyu Kim, Woo-sung Kim

Publication number: 20070119194Abstract: A control method of a refrigerator comprising an ice storing part storing and discharging ice cubes, an ice shaving unit shaving the ice cubes discharged from the ice storing part to make shaved ice, an ice transferring driving part supplying the ice cubes stored in the ice storing part to the ice shaving unit, and an ice shaving unit driving part driving the ice shaving unit to make the shaved ice. The method includes: setting on/off reference times for the ice transferring driving part so that the ice transferring driving part operates according to a predetermined operation period; storing final on/off times elapsed from a final operation period of the ice transferring driving part when the ice shaving unit driving part is stopped; and driving the ice transferring driving part for the final on/off times remaining from the final operation period, and then driving the ice transferring driving part according to the operation period when the ice shaving unit driving part is driven again.Type: ApplicationFiled: October 31, 2006Publication date: May 31, 2007Applicant: Samsung Electronics Co., Ltd.Inventors: Woo-sung Kim, Sang-yun Lee

Publication number: 20060274447Abstract: A disk mounting hub has a disk-mounting face formed at one end as a truncated conical surface of revolution symmetric about a central axis. A cylindrical inner hub member is coaxial with the hub body outside diameter and the surrounding mounting face. The inner hub member is adapted to receive a planar disk with a central opening. The mounting face is disposed at a hub face angle (n/2+/?1) relative to the central axis. Hub face angle ? is selected so that a disk clamping force F applied to an inner disk portion surrounding the opening bends a portion of the disk interior to the hub inside diameter to conform with the conical disk-mounting face. This interior bending portion reduces or eliminates the tendency of the outer disk portion to form an excessive conning angle ?.Type: ApplicationFiled: August 15, 2006Publication date: December 7, 2006Inventors: Woo-Sung Kim, Sung-Wook Kim, Eui-Sup Ka

Patent number: 6955854Abstract: The present invention relates to a high tenacity polyethylene naphthalate fiber containing a silica compound. This fiber is produced by a method comprising the steps of: (A) melt-spinning a solid phase-polymerized polyethylene-2,6-naphthalate chip containing ethylene-2,6-naphthalate units at more than 85 mole % and a silica compound and having an intrinsic viscosity of 0.70-1.20, to produce a melt-spun yarn; (B) passing the melt-spun yarn through a retarded cooling zone and a cooling zone to solidify the yarn; (C) withdrawing the yarn at such a speed that the undrawn yarn has a birefringence of 0.001-0.1; and (D) subjecting the undrawn yarn to multi-stage drawing at a total draw ratio of at least 1.5 and a drawing temperature of 50-250° C.Type: GrantFiled: January 23, 2004Date of Patent: October 18, 2005Assignee: Hyosung CorporationInventors: Ik-Hyeon Kwon, Woo-Sung Kim, Yun-Hyuk Bang, Young-Jo Kim, Chan-Min Park
